    Date : 22th - 26th February

    Top two seeds for each category
    MS - Liew Daren (1), Mohammad Arif Abdul Latif (2)
    WS - Tee Jing Yi (1), Lydia Cheah (2)
    MD - Mohd Lutfi Zaim/Vountus Indra Mawan (1), Chan Chong Ming/Lee Wan Wah (2)
    WD - Chin Eei Hui/Wong Pei Tty (1), Vivian Hoo/Woon Khe Wei (2)
    XD - Chan Peng Soon/Goh Liu Ying (1), Tan Aik Quan/Lai Pei Jing (2)

    Lee Chong Wei is in the XD list, playing with Vivian Hoo.

    Results involving players for Dutch & German Juniors 2012:
    BS SF - Soong Joo Ven vs Tan Kian Meng; Chong Yee Han vs Soo Teck Zhi
    All the European bound players for the BS (except for Lim Chi Wing) have progressed to SF as expected.

    BD SF
    - Calvin Ong Jia Hong/Tan Wee Gieen vs Chua Kek Wei/Ong Yew Sin; Darren Isaac Devadass/Tai An Khang vs Tew Gee Chong/Yeoh Choong Yee

    The other pairs: Soo Teck Zhi/Soong Joo Ven and Chong Yee Han/Tan Kian Meng, Lim Chi Wing/Vincent Phuah Cheng Wei lost in R16 and QF respectively. Chong Yee Han will be partnered with Lim Chi Wing for the European Junior events.

    My question is: are these players in BS & BD the best that could represent MAS for the major Junior events this year? Shesar Hiren Rhustavito will probably be INA's best bet for BS in AJC & WJC this year but he's not going to Europe. As for BD, 3 main pairs that could cross paths with MAS's pairs in the Dutch & German Juniors: Edi Subaktiar/Arya Maulana Aldiartama, Felix Kinalsal/Kevin Sanjaya Sukamuljo and Hafiz Faisal/Putra Eka Rhoma.
